Description

Jayne Anne Phillips has been highly praised in the past for her prose - mainly for the novels Shelter and Machine Dreams (Greek translation by Lisa Samloglou, titled Machines of Dreams, published by Estia bookstore).
In her recent novel, Phillips deals with the complex themes of motherhood, birth, love, and death with great literary skill. Describing a melancholic and harsh everyday life, light years away from the American dream. Illuminating the deeper instincts and emotions, the conflicts and contradictions that life entails for Kate - the heroine - as she experiences pregnancy and motherhood while her mother dies of cancer. Being the mother of her own child while her own mother is in a phase where she is unable to take care of herself, Kate becomes a mother at the same time, transitioning almost instantaneously from bohemian carefreeness to a more complex reality.
An illusory peaceful story about our world, a world where the most important things happen without cause, without explanation, and without the possibility of return. A book about what happens within us when everything we knew is lost, while violently realizing our weakness and, at the same time, our absurdly great power.
